10-02-07 Looking back

Published 12:00 am Tuesday, October 2, 2007

TWENTY YEARS AGO — Carlos Woods scores two touchdowns and comes up with a key sack as South Natchez’s JV team defeats Brookhaven 32-26 in double overtime and Darrin Clark throws for 116 yards and three touchdowns as North Natchez’s JV team gets by Port Gibson 46-0.

TEN YEARS AGO — Jeff Blauser hits a three-run home run, Fred McGriff adds an RBI single and Atlanta takes advantage of eight walks by Houston pitcher Mike Hampton as the Braves defeat the Astros 13-3 to take a 2-0 lead in the National League Championship Series.

FIVE YEARS AGO — The ACCS Rebels will take a two-game winning streak into their road game Friday night against the Jackson Prep Patriots, but they will have to rely on the passing of Eric Anders and the running of Luke Ogden to have any chance of pulling off the upset.
